    So....not sure which thread the oil, lack of, discussion was on but a reminder to my SF and GTS brethren....please check your oil! My car was in for annual service a month or so ago and has only done about 300 miles since. When I checked the oil yesterday the sick was dry....literally the whole thing. And that’s crazy because there are several inches below the low mark! I am on my third qt....adding slowly, driving, cooling and checking again but based on other posters I could see this being 5 plus. Obviously no dripping so a real head scratcher. Hope everyone is on top of this. Safe driving!
